#f22933 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f22933 is composed of 94.9% red, 16.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.1% magenta, 78.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 357 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 55.5%. #f22933 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5266 with #e50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f22933 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f22933 has RGB values of R:242, G:41,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.79,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15870259.

Shades and Tints of #f22933

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080001 is the darkest color, while #fef4f5 is the lightest one.
